Design validation may take the form of qualification tests which stress the product up to and beyond design limits - beta tests where products are supplied to several typical users on trial in order to gather operational performance data, performance trials, and reliability and maintainability trials where products are put on test for prolonged periods to simulate usage conditions. [Pg.265]

Performance trials are conducted to determine the use pattern required for effective pesticide performance. Much effort goes into determining the minimum effective rate. Usually, about 30 trials are required per major pest. Initial performance testing is usually conducted on company research farms. For crops and pests that cannot be handled internally, contractors are used. The differences between residue and performance trials create difficulties in designing an electronic system that can handle both smdy types well. [Pg.1034]

As defined by ICH and GCP guidelines, a subinveshgator is any individual member of the clinical trial team designated and directly supervised by the PI to perform trial-related procedures or make trial-related decisions (Sechon 1.56, p. 13). ° Examples of subinvestigators include other physicians, pharmacists, pharmacologists, nurses, and study coordinators. [Pg.424]

Besides the number of trials as defined by the choice of design of experiments, it is important to determine the number of replicated trials. Replications are necessary to eliminate robust errors and to determine the reproducibility variance or error of experiment. Since the reproducibility variance has in this case been quite reliably determined in previous study, we may therefore accept a minimal number of replications or a single replication (Sy2=1.0). Prior to doing an experiment one should define the sequence of performing trials, which should be random to annul systematic errors or outside effects.
